Insuring your home is always a good idea. To know how much it costs to insure your home, you have to know against what exactly you want to insure it. The more things you want to insure it against, the more money you will have to pay. For example, if you insure it against burglary, you will need to pay less amount of money then in the case you want to insure it against, say, earthquakes too. Also, the cost depends on the probability of damage. If you live in a very safe neighborhood, you will need to pay less money than if you lived in a notorious one.
